H.R.705 — 93rd Congress (1973-1974) [93rd]
Sponsor:
Rep. Koch, Edward I. [D-NY-18] (Introduced 01/03/1973)

Summary:
Summary: H.R.705 — 93rd Congress (1973-1974)

There is one summary for this bill. Bill summaries are authored by CRS.

Shown Here:
Introduced in House (01/03/1973)

Provides a full exemption (through credit or refund) from the employees' tax under the Federal Insurance Contributions Act, for purposes of title II of the Social Security Act (Old-Age, Survivors' and Disability Insurance) and an equivalent reduction in the self-employment tax, in the case of individuals who have attained age 65. (Amends 26 U.S.C. 1401)
